加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.ruian888.cn/)- 科技、操作系统、数据工具、数据湖、智能数字人!
当前位置: 首页 > 综合聚焦 > 网络游戏 > 网页游戏 > 正文

网页游戏架构升级与阵容算法优化策略

发布时间:2026-01-24 15:16:10 所属栏目:网页游戏 来源:DaWei
导读:   在网页游戏开发中,随着用户规模扩大与玩法复杂度提升,系统架构和核心算法的优化成为决定产品生命周期的关键。传统的单体架构难以支撑高并发请求,而阵容搭配等核心玩法若计算效率低下

  在网页游戏开发中,随着用户规模扩大与玩法复杂度提升,系统架构和核心算法的优化成为决定产品生命周期的关键。传统的单体架构难以支撑高并发请求,而阵容搭配等核心玩法若计算效率低下,将直接影响玩家体验。因此,架构升级与阵容算法双优化策略应运而生,旨在从底层技术与上层逻辑两个维度同步发力,实现性能与体验的双重突破。


  架构升级的核心在于解耦与分布式部署。将原本集中处理用户登录、战斗计算、数据存储等功能的单一服务器拆分为多个微服务模块,如用户中心、战斗引擎、匹配系统等,通过消息队列与API网关进行通信。这种设计不仅提升了系统的可维护性,也增强了横向扩展能力。当某一功能模块面临高负载时,可独立扩容,避免全局性能瓶颈。同时,引入Redis缓存热门数据,减少数据库直接访问频次,显著降低响应延迟。


  在前端层面,采用WebSocket替代传统HTTP轮询,实现客户端与服务器之间的实时双向通信。这对于需要即时反馈的战斗场景尤为重要。玩家操作可即时上传,服务器也能主动推送战局变化,大幅提升交互流畅度。结合CDN加速静态资源加载,进一步缩短页面初始化时间,让新玩家快速进入游戏世界。


  阵容算法是策略类网页游戏的核心逻辑之一,其优化直接影响匹配公平性与策略深度。传统实现常依赖遍历所有可能组合进行评分计算,时间复杂度高,难以适应实时需求。通过引入启发式搜索与动态规划思想,可在保证结果合理性的前提下大幅减少计算量。例如,预设英雄强度权重,结合阵营加成规则构建评估函数,优先筛选高潜力阵容,跳过明显劣势组合。


  为进一步提升效率,可将部分计算任务前置至客户端完成初步筛选,服务器仅做最终校验与仲裁,减轻后端压力。同时,利用机器学习模型分析历史对战数据,训练出更贴近实战表现的阵容评分模型,并定期更新参数,使推荐结果更具智能性与适应性。该机制既可用于AI对手的智能布阵,也可为新人玩家提供个性化阵容建议。


2026AI生成图片,仅供参考

  双优化策略的成功实施,离不开持续监控与迭代机制。通过埋点收集接口响应时间、算法执行耗时、用户停留时长等关键指标,建立可视化报表,及时发现性能拐点。开发团队可根据数据反馈调整服务配置或优化算法逻辑,形成闭环改进流程。自动化测试平台的引入,也能确保每次更新不会引入新的性能退化问题。


  本站观点,网页游戏的技术演进已不再局限于美术表现或玩法创新,底层架构的健壮性与核心算法的高效性正成为竞争壁垒。通过系统化的架构升级与智能化的算法优化协同推进,不仅能承载更大规模的用户并发,还能为玩家提供更公平、更流畅的游戏体验,从而在激烈的市场环境中赢得先机。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章